This … WebSep 16, 2014 · Expansion tanks within a closed loop system will act as the point of constant pressure and be considered the reference pressure for the system, and will also allow for the expansion or contraction of the CHW … WebSep 1, 2024 · That something is a predetermined volume of air that stays within a closed hydronic system. The container for that air is called an expansion tank. As the system’s water expands it pushes against the air in the tank causing it to compress. Cold fill pressure is defined as the initial pressure required to lift water from the point of the gauge readout to the top of the system plus 4 PSIG for positive venting. It doesn't depend on the capacity of the chiller. It depends only on the variation of the water specific volume between the minimum and the maximum temperatures of the water.
